What is LGPS Leaving Form
The Local Government Pension Scheme Leaving Form is a pension document used by employees to specify their preferred option for pension contributions upon leaving the LGPS.

What are the eligibility requirements for using the LGPS Leaving Form?
To use the Local Government Pension Scheme Leaving Form, you must be an employee currently enrolled in the LGPS who is leaving the scheme and wishes to specify how your pension contributions should be handled.
Is there a deadline for submitting the LGPS Leaving Form?
While there may not be a strict deadline, it is advisable to submit the form as soon as you decide to leave your employment with the LGPS to avoid delays in processing your pension options.
How should I submit the completed LGPS Leaving Form?
Once you have completed and signed the LGPS Leaving Form, you should submit it to your HR department or the pension administrator as per your organization’s guidelines.
Are there any supporting documents needed with the LGPS Leaving Form?
Generally, you may need to provide identification or employment verification alongside the LGPS Leaving Form. However, specific requirements can vary; always check with your HR department.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the LGPS Leaving Form?
Common mistakes include leaving required fields empty, failing to sign and date the form, and selecting an incorrect option for handling pension contributions. Double-check all entries before submission.
How long does it take for the LGPS Leaving Form to be processed?
Processing times can vary based on the specific pension scheme and volume of submissions. Typically, you can expect processing to take several weeks. It's wise to inquire with your pension administrator for detailed time frames.
